Is Leetcode Enough For Faang Interviews? What You Need To Know

 thumbnail

Is Leetcode Enough For Faang Interviews? What You Need To Know

Published Mar 13, 25
8 min read
[=headercontent]The Best Courses To Prepare For A Microsoft Software Engineering Interview [/headercontent] [=image]
How To Fast-track Your Faang Interview Preparation

How To Crack Faang Interviews – A Step-by-step Guide




[/video]

You're fortunate if you have a great teacher at school, and otherwise, I always go back to MIT OCW's Intro to Algorithms training course. There is also a graduate variation, 6.042 J, which you can do if 6.006 is as well easy for you. And this is for the 4th type of interview rounds - you might have one more style (item oriented or systems) round or a mathematics round (I needed to prepare both for Microsoft), and I will certainly repeat the same point right here - it is so essential to go back to the essentials.

As you can currently visualize - this is a lot of prep work. Which is why you need to start beforehand. If you wait for that interview telephone call, you will have less than 2 weeks in most instances to prepare on your own and I will certainly leave that up to you to decide if that suffices for you.

Fact be told, I have extra models and versions of my resume than I would love to confess. However reflecting, I don't believe there is any kind of shame because. The factor I obtained all of those interviews and after that, the specific groups that I intended to function in was since of that single sheet of resume that I uploaded on the first day.

Return to creating is a skill, and one that requires to build. There are no certifications that can aid you do that, just test and error. Yet error in these competitive times is nearly fatal so the following finest thing is obtaining responses. Don't be afraid of denial from your peers.

the listing takes place. Completion goal is to have one generic copy of your resume ready which has actually been prepared such that it shows all of your abilities, and other individuals can see that. You can now fine-tune this according to the business you are relating to and the credentials that they are searching for.

I like it myself - I simply do not believe it is a reliable resource for the first stages of your prep work. The advantage of making use of LeetCode, whether you like it or despise it, is that it has layouts of concerns frequently used by tech companies in coding rounds. Obtaining practice will only assist you! The method is to construct a skill that can aid you decode - offered this issue, what are the formulas in my "tool kit" that I can utilize to fix this trouble.

The 100 Most Common Coding Interview Problems & How To Solve Them

If I had to give you my very own example, I have not also touched 200 questions on LeetCode myself and I believe I did quite well in my interviews. The other source that people like to utilize is Splitting the Coding Meeting. I have that publication, I believe it is fantastic, I simply have never had the ability to utilize it myself.

Actual meetings will have at least one more person, if not even more and it is necessary that you have exercised giving the interview to one various other individual (and not simply your display). Technical Interviews are not simply regarding composing the excellent code and making certain it assembles, you will certainly likewise have to explain your thought process and why you are doing what you are doing.

Why Communication Skills Matter In Software Engineering Interviews

Why Faang Companies Focus On Problem-solving Skills In Interviews


Occasionally if you are lacking time and can't complete the code, yet can describe what your intents are, you might still escape and clear that round. I will return to the very same thing that I claimed is vital for your return to: feedback. We are all terrified of failing and letting somebody else know what our flaws are, however better a friend/peer than than the job interviewer.

Cracking The Mid-level Software Engineer Interview – Part I (Concepts & Frameworks)

It will certainly assist me make content better suited to the needs of individuals visiting. If you have particular questions about any component of the process, drop them right here!.

This is still meant to be a sensible, not academic, discussion. Draw from your previous experience and usage accurate instances to discuss what you would certainly do and why. And like all of our meeting inquiries, it will be designed to "ladder," implying your recruiter's follow-ups can get moreor lesschallenging as you proceed.

How To Get Free Faang Interview Coaching & Mentorship

The Best Courses For Full-stack Developer Interview Preparation


This is component of exactly how we analyze finding out dexterity; we wish to know how well you believe on your feet. In the manager meeting, we'll speak about who you are todayand that you desire to go to Atlassian. Naturally, throughout the meeting procedure, we want to make sure we are familiar with candidates as humansand we desire them to get to recognize us.

Software Developer (Sde) Interview & Placement Guide – How To Stand Out

So in this sessionusually one-on-one with either the hiring manager or a much more elderly supervisor on the teamwe'll ask concerns made to comprehend not just who you are, but additionally what you have an interest in and delighted around. We'll chat regarding exactly how you can add value not just in the duty and group you're making an application for, yet in your long-lasting career at Atlassian.

We'll likewise utilize this session to find out as long as we can around just how you work, specifically your collaboration and communication designs. See to it you're prepared to chat regarding a past project or 2, from who you collaborated with to the technical difficulties you needed to conquer. You can additionally talk to business validation for the projectthe reason you were dealing with it to begin with.

Keep in mind, we're below to assist you, not to stump you. If you do not understand what to do, say so! Communication and partnership are crucial skills on our group, so just think of it as an additional chance to reveal your things. The values interview is developed to examine your alignment withand answer your concerns aboutAtlassian's 5 values.

Google Vs. Facebook Software Engineering Interviews – Key Differences

How To Optimize Your Resume For Faang Software Engineering Jobs


The latter modifications as we expand, and differs from office to office. However our values remain the exact same. They're the backbone on which a sustainable business is built. And because our values are woven into our practices, procedures, and the method we run our groups, your values job interviewer likely won't belong to the team you're applying to sign up with; maybe somebody from Sales, HR, or Client Assistance.

Our objective is to understand your frame of mind, and the means it guides your activities. After successfully finishing the meeting process, your interviewers will combine feedback and debrief. If there's an excellent fit in between your abilities and experience, you will proceed to the last in the process - being reviewed by a Hiring Board.

How To Optimize Your Resume For Faang Software Engineering Jobs

Atlassian hiring committee participants are different from the recruiters you will satisfy and only have access to particular information associating with the meeting process (this includes meeting comments and CV info). The working with committee will look holistically at abilities, toughness and behaviours, making certain an unbiased employing decision. As you experience this process, we want you to have an excellent experience - and we wish to do whatever we can to draw out the very best in you, since it's your ideal that will determine just how you can add to our group.

If you don't recognize what to do, state so! Communication and partnership are key abilities on our group, so just think about it as an additional chance to show your stuff. Crucial, know that we're not hiring with one excellent candidate in mind. Instead, we're bringing in individuals with a wide range of skills, histories, and point of views, and providing every possible possibility to place their ideal foot onward.

How To Get A Faang Job Without Paying For An Expensive Bootcamp

10 Proven Strategies To Ace Your Next Software Engineering Interview


Sufficient prep work not only boosts your self-confidence however also assists you showcase your proficiency and stand out from the competitors. This is where ChatGPT action in. Created by OpenAI, ChatGPT is a remarkable device that can transform your interview preparation experience. With its comprehensive expertise and conversational capacities, ChatGPT becomes your trusted buddy, giving beneficial assistance, understandings, and support throughout your trip.

Google Tech Dev Guide – Mastering Software Engineering Interview Prep

This blog site aims to guide software program designers on how to utilize ChatGPT efficiently for interview preparation. From gathering interview info to practicing technological concerns and improving soft abilities, this blog site will certainly help you make the most of ChatGPT as a useful resource. By the end of this blog site, you will certainly have a clear understanding of how to efficiently make use of ChatGPT to enhance your possibilities of success in software program designer interviews.

These meetings evaluate your capacity to make scalable and reliable software systems. You might be asked to detail the design, elements, and scalability factors to consider for a given scenario.

It has the prospective to be a useful resource for software program programmers that are planning for meetings. ChatGPT can aid in preparing interview questions, practicing technological problems, and enhancing soft abilities to its huge data base and capability to create pertinent and informative answers. ChatGPT can be a terrific source for interview preparation, providing many opportunities to enhance your preparedness.

Tech Interview Handbook: A Technical Interview Guide For Busy Engineers

ChatGPT serves as your online recruiter, supplying you an immersive preparation experience with its interactive and dynamic conversational capacities. "I'm presently planning for a job interview in (Job Title). Could you please play the role of recruiter and ask me some questions? Please ask me (Variety of Inquiries) inquiries, one at a time:"Use ChatGPT to Practice Mock Meeting "As a (Your Role) prospect, I am presently getting ready for this setting.

Could you please produce interview questions connected to these concepts to assist me exercise?" Have a look at this real-time ChatGPT conversation: If you anticipate meeting inquiries but lack the answers, ChatGPT can be a useful resource. It can produce reactions to assist you comprehend and get ready for those concerns, providing important insights to assist you boost your knowledge and readiness.